QlikSense features for Contributor access

 

 

Hi All,

Need your inputs on the below query.

Could you please let us know the different features available in QlikSense  for business user for their self service analytics when they have Contributor user access.

Also kindly confirm the major difference between Developer and Contributor access.

"Developer" and "Contributor" are pseudo-roles you will create in that given example by assigning custom properties.  Those are not out of the box roles.  Follow the example to see what privileges they assign to each. And of course you can adjust to fit your requirements.
